Looked at their online inventory and found a vehicle I was interested. When I showed up to test drive it (after speaking with a general customer service rep and the salesman), I was informed that the mileage on the vehicle was misrepresented...by 60,000 miles. When I declined to drive the vehicle based on the fact that it had more mileage than my current vehicle, the salesman proceeded to try to upsell me to something beyond my stated price range, again with higher miles. After showing me how to use a basic search engine, I finally had enough and left. The mileage is still incorrect on the site.
